American Dog Owners Association Urges NFL To Suspend Michael Vick in Wake of Dogfighting Indictment

The American Dog Owners Association (ADOA), formed in 1970 to combat dogfighting, announced today that it is calling for the National Football League (NFL) to suspend Atlanta Falcons quarterback Michael Vick in response to his recent indictment by a federal grand jury for allegedly participating in an interstate dogfighting enterprise.

According to the indictment, Michael Vick and three co-defendants were involved in an ongoing animal fighting venture from early 2001 through April 2007. During that time, the defendants allegedly ran a dog fighting enterprise known as "Bad Newz Kennels" operated on the grounds of a Smithfield, Va. property owned by Michael Vick since 2001. Said property was used for housing and training American Pit Bull Terriers used in the dog fights that took place there and in other US locations. The indictment further alleges that each dog fight would continue until the death or surrender of the losing dog. At the end of the fight, the losing dog was often put to death by drowning, hanging, gunshot, electrocution, or slamming.... (Continue reading)

Hundreds of Canadians Witness Success of Online Mapping Demonstration

The Carbon Project announces that its CarbonArc and Gaia software has successfully supported the Canadian Geospatial Data Infrastructure (CGDI) Interoperability Pilot, most recently at a November 30 online demonstration attended by over 500 people from across Canada.

An overview of the demonstration, including online videos of CarbonArc and Gaia, is available at http://www.ogcnetwork.net/cgdi.

The CGDI Interoperability Pilot is sponsored by GeoConnections, a Canadian partnership program led by Natural Resources Canada. The program works with decision-makers and technology developers to increase the use and sharing of location-based (or "geospatial") information and technologies online, via the Canadian Geospatial Data Infrastructure (www.cgdi.ca). In the pilot, GeoConnections is collaborating with provincial partners to test better mechanisms for distributing and updating framework data (geographic names, national road network, administrative boundaries, etc.)--providing users with access to the most current and authoritative data, avoiding version disparities, and minimizing duplication.... Bio-Tec Environmental Introduces Their New Plastic Additive Showing 45% Biodegradation of Plastics in Just 14 Days

After several years in development, Bio-Tec Environmental today launched its next-generation biodegradable plastics additive. The new product passed ASTM International's strictest test for anaerobic biodegradation of plastic materials and far surpasses its predecessor in economy and performance.

Their new formulation biodegrades materials up to five times faster than Bio-Batch. It can be used at 0.7% by load weight to render most plastic materials 100% biodegradable in time. As validated by the ASTM method of anaerobic biodegradation, the accelerated rate of action allows microbes to break down the structure of polypropylene and polyethylene up to 45% in 14 days. Third party testing for PVC, polystyrene, PET, EVA and various other major resins confirms the superior results.... (Continue reading)
